Orange Cashmere Woollen Paisley Stole Shawl - France Circa 1850
Located in Toulon, FR
Circa 1850/1855
France
Rare Woven shawl with a cut-out lancet shape that adorns the shoulders of the elegant crinoline from the end of the Louis Philippe period. Lush vegetal decor loaded with wavy stems boteh rising in the bright orange central reserve. This type of Visite stole, made available on a Jacquard loom, was initiated by Amédée Couder at the Universal Exhibition in Paris 1839 and in particular produced by the Maison Parisienne...

A french squared Paisley Moon Shawl woven silk and wool Circa 1830
Located in Toulon, FR
Circa 1820/1840
France
Rare French cashmere shawl woven on a silk and wool drawloom called Moon Shawl and dating from the Romantic period. A square shawl with a cream background, intended for the elegant ladies of the Restoration and often in a wedding basket, whose design deliberately imitates Indian shawls. Very fine cut-out throw weave with a large central moon and quarter moons at the corners with Mille fleurs motifs in predominantly blue, red, green and saffron. Cream tapered fringes on two sides.
